Rules for Establishing Long Lasting Relationships


1. Seek to understand the individual deeply without trying to change or being judgmental.
2. Make commitments you can keep and keep those commitments.
3. Give them the care and attention the way they need it, NOT the way you THINK they need it or the way YOU need it.
4. Know when to shut up.
5. Give the freedom to live their life without passing judgment and be there when things go wrong.
6. Focus more on the things they do well and only give advice when they ask for it.
7. Learn to let go if and when required.
8. Help to develop the capability to fight their own battles.
9. Act with sincerity and integrity at all times.
10. Accept the imperfections with grace as they make human beings much more adorable.
11. Tell or show them that you care. Very few can read minds.
12. Be direct and upfront (But timing is key!) .
13. Ask and give feedback on the relationship and keep changing yourself as you go along.
14. Face conflicts with the intention of improving the relationship. Never avoid them.
15. Never force to change their behavior.
16. Never do anything for personal gain.
17. Apologies when required.

One relationship that is built this way will be more enriching than 10 mediocre relationships.
